Sentinels have emerged as the champions of Marvel Rivals Ignite Stage 1 Americas, triumphing over 100 Thieves in a thrilling seven-game Grand Final. The victory marks another high point in the organization’s growing legacy within the competitive Marvel Rivals scene, echoing their dominance in previous events.
Despite facing adversity in the group stage, Sentinels turned the tide in the playoffs, launching a relentless campaign that saw them defeat several top-tier teams. Their playoff run included decisive victories over ENVY and tekixd, before clashing with 100 Thieves in the Upper Bracket Final. Sentinels edged out a narrow 3-2 win in that encounter, sending 100 Thieves to the Lower Bracket.
Undeterred, 100 Thieves rallied back with a strong performance against ENVY, the reigning Shroud Gauntlet champions, to set up a high-stakes rematch in the Grand Finals. The final showdown between Sentinels and 100 Thieves lived up to all expectations, with the match going the full distance of seven intense games.
Here’s how the Grand Finals played out:

- Game 1: Sentinels 2-1 100 Thieves – Birnin T’Challa (Domination)
- Game 2: Sentinels 1-3 100 Thieves – Yggdrasil Path (Convoy)
- Game 3: Sentinels 1-2 100 Thieves – Hall of Djalia (Convergence)
- Game 4: Sentinels 2-0 100 Thieves – Hell’s Heaven (Domination)
- Game 5: Sentinels 2-3 100 Thieves – Spider-Islands (Convoy)
- Game 6: Sentinels 3-1 100 Thieves – Central Park (Convergence)
- Game 7: Sentinels 3-2 100 Thieves – Midtown (Convoy)
Final Score: Sentinels 4 – 3 100 Thieves
This win wasn’t just about the title; it also secured Sentinels, 100 Thieves, and ENVY a coveted spot in the upcoming Mid-Season Finals in Hangzhou, China. The offline tournament will serve as a global proving ground, bringing together the top teams from various regions.
Following the win, Chassidy ‘aramori’ Kaye, a strategist player for Sentinels, shared her excitement for the upcoming international stage. She noted the team’s prior scrims against top European and Asian teams like Rad EU, Brr Brr Patapim, and Gen.G, expressing eagerness to compete with them under tournament pressure.
“Obviously, we were hoping to play Virtus.pro, but they didn’t qualify. Still, we’ve played against many of the top teams before, and it’s going to be really fun showing what we can do internationally,” said Kaye during the Grand Finals livestream.
